## Runbook: Lumenkit Component Library Versioning

Before cutting a release of Lumenkit, confirm that every consuming app in the Farrowgate workspace has acknowledged the deprecation manifest. Minor bumps must not remove exported tokens; if the diff scanner flags a removal, escalate to the design-systems rotation rather than overriding. Tag the release branch only after the canary apps pass visual regression. Record the canary outcome in the ledger, then paste the identifier shown below.

session token of bawep-yadup = htk21_528abd376e3c5a4ec24a1

## Environment Variables: Offline Mode

Terracount's offline mode caches survey plots locally and queues uploads. No network calls occur until reconnect. Cached data is encrypted at rest; the cipher is initialized at startup and never logged. Reviewers should confirm the variable is absent from CI logs. To enable encrypted offline caching, the device's environment file must contain this line:

secret setting of bajeg-yahog: LEDGER_TOKEN20=f833f3e2e6625ec0dee3

## Service Accounts — Tilegrove Cache Layer

The Tilegrove cache layer sits between the renderer and the Mapforge origin. Each contractor receives a dedicated service account scoped to cache invalidation and warmup endpoints only; origin writes are off-limits. Accounts expire after 90 days and are renewed by the infra rotation. To authenticate your tooling against the staging cache, use the key issued below.

app token of yajeg-kawef = kto11_7En3XSX8xQw

### RBAC verification for LoomWiki

When reviewing changes to LoomWiki's role-based access layer, confirm that every role addition updates both the permission matrix and the audit-event map; a mismatch between the two has previously allowed silent privilege escalation for space moderators. Also verify the anonymous role remains read-only and that inheritance depth stays capped. The access service evaluates permissions against the following configuration values.

settings of yageg-yahap:
[gorael]
team = olieth
access_code = ac_941d74
owner = brieth.aldiel
host = gorael.tolvaqio.internal
port = 6379
peer = briwyn.urlaqtech.internal
salt = 116e6622
pin = 1957